Transaction
1dacddfecbbe172fc8718f73a5eda61d6c40abfcbaeeef4e57a9d0eaa3350b41
view on ordpool.space
1 Input
1 Output
-
1dacddfecbbe172fc8718f73a5eda61d6c40abfcbaeeef4e57a9d0eaa3350b41:0
- value
- 3121648
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81b44faca40829b195deda3505dc53e781f9081a OP_EQUAL
- address
- 3DWq6XuQdS4g1DHFocQbCKnPxfsErHssta